SCSC -Student Success Plans, CTE Updates, and Ai



Enriching three-hour professional development session aimed at equipping educators with the latest tools and strategies for fostering student success and innovation in the classroom. This session will cover three key areas: Launching New Student Success Plans (SSPs): Participants will receive comprehensive guidance on the implementation of new Student Success Plans (SSPs), designed to support students in setting and achieving their academic and personal goals.Through interactive discussions and practical exercises, educators will explore effective ways to tailor SSPs to meet the diverse needs of their students.Strategies for fostering student ownership and accountability in the SSP process will be shared, empowering educators to facilitate meaningful conversations and goal-setting sessions with their students. Learning the New Career and Technical Education (CTE) Updates: Stay ahead of the curve with updates on the latest developments in Career and Technical Education (CTE) curriculum and standards. Educators will gain insights into new industry trends, emerging job sectors, and advancements in CTE pathways, ensuring alignment with evolving workforce demands. Practical tips and resources will be provided to help educators integrate the latest CTE updates seamlessly into their instructional practices, fostering career readiness and relevance for students. Best Uses of AI in the Classroom:Discover innovative ways to leverage Artificial Intelligence (AI) tools and technologies to enhance teaching and learning experiences. From personalized learning platforms to AI-driven assessment tools, participants will explore a range of applications that can optimize classroom instruction and student engagement.
